New York, NY: Random House, 1968 Random House, New York. 1968. Hardcover. Stated First Printing. Signed by the author on the FFFP. Book is tight, square, and unmarked. Book Condition: Near Fine; slight bottom board rubbing. DJ: Very Good; NOT Price Clipped; bumping and small closed tears on top edge. 215 pp 8vo. One of the best-known religious figures of this generation, the author was an early Freedom Rider, a leader in civil rights and the Peace Movement. In this book he is concerned with secular realities; Vietnam, Black Revolution, sexual freedom, world hypocrisy, anti-Semitism, and the Underground Church. A original work comprising his views as he observes in his times. A clean very presentable copy in a Brodart mylar jacket.
